Mr. Oscar Lee Thompson, age 60 and of 29051 Eddie Pittman Road in Angie, departed this life Sunday, Nov. 9, 2014, at his residence.

Survivors include his mother, Rita Tate, and his brother, James Earl Ploughman, both of Angie; one aunt, Mary P. Wicker of Chicago; one adopted aunt, Mary J. Wicker of Bogalusa; and a host of nieces, nephews and other relatives and friends.

He was preceded in death by his father, Johnny Thompson; one sister, Sarah Ann Ploughman; stepfather, Eugene Tate; three aunts, Susie Roberts, Sofia Peters and Deane Rayford; and three uncles, John Lee, Henry and Lawyer Ploughman.

He completed his high school education at Varnado High School in Varnado.

Oscar confessed his faith in Christ at an early age at Center Baptist Church and was baptized by the late Rev. Dr. Lynwood Bolton. He remained a faithful member until his death under the leadership of the Rev. Sidney Jones.

Visitation will be held on Sunday, Nov. 16, 2014, at the chapel of Crain and Sons Funeral Home in Bogalusa from 2 p.m. until 5 p.m., followed by a family hour from 6 p.m. until 7 p.m.

Funeral services will be held on Monday, Nov. 17, 2014, at Crain and Sons at 1 p.m., with Pastor Leroy Henry III officiating.

Interment will follow in the Robinson Cemetery in Angie.

Crain and Sons Funeral Home of Bogalusa is in charge of arrangements.
